💬What is Save My Skibidi?
Okay, so this one is pure internet brainrot in the best possible way. You get a Skibidi toilet on screen — yes, the singing head in a toilet — and it's slowly sinking or getting dragged down by something absurd. Your job? Click the hell out of it. Each click gives it a little boost, a little squirm, a little burst of energy to fight back against whatever force is pulling it under.
The first time I played, I underestimated how fast the meter drains. I was casually clicking, then suddenly the toilet started spiraling and I lost it. That's when it clicked: you're not just tapping, you're managing a tiny, chaotic bar of survival. The animation is goofy as hell — the Skibidi head bobs and weaves with every click, and there's this weird satisfaction when you get into a rhythm and it stabilizes. The sound design (if you have volume on) is exactly the kind of meme-y, distorted nonsense you'd expect. It's dumb, it's frantic, and it's strangely compelling.
Honestly, this is a game that knows exactly what it is: a quick hit of absurdity. Don't go in looking for depth. Go in looking to click like a maniac and maybe set a new high score before your finger cramps. I kept coming back just to see if I could beat my own ridiculous record. ✨Game Tips
Click with two fingers alternating to keep a steady rhythm — one finger alone will tire out fast on longer runs.
Watch the Skibidi's eyes or the bar (if there is one) — they telegraph when you're about to lose grip, so burst-click when it dips.
Don't spam as fast as possible from the start; find the minimum click rate that holds it steady, then ramp up when it starts slipping.
If the game allows pausing between clicks, tiny micro-rests help you survive longer, but don't let it drop too far.
Play on a desk with a mouse if possible — trackpad clicking gets messy when you're trying to go fast.
